As a teacher of 30 years, Michelle knows how important it is to seek a diagnosis if there are any signs pointing to a possibility of a student having ADHD. So often parents choose not to follow up concerns presented by teachers, forgetting that teachers experience their children in completely different  ways than they would  at home.

 

A diagnosis often EMPOWERS students to be who they are meant to be and allow their educators to understand how they can ELEVATE a neurodiverse student. As someone with ADHD, Michelle can affirm that the only people who don’t appreciate an ADHD diagnosis are people who don’t have ADHD. For those with ADHD, it is liberating... a feeling of finally being understood.
